Occupational Summary:

Duke Women's Basketball seeks a creative, energetic, and detail-oriented Digital Engagement and Strategy Coordinator to support the program's digital presence through content creation, social media, and storytelling. This position will serve as the primary day-to-day manager of the program's digital platforms, leading social media strategy and execution while helping drive audience growth, fan engagement, and brand development.

Social Media Management

* Assist in the day-to-day management of Duke Women's Basketball social media accounts.

* Schedule, publish, and monitor content across all digital platforms.

* Support game day and event day social media coverage.

* Maintain content calendars and ensure timely execution of digital campaigns.

Content Creation

* Capture and create photo, video, and short-form content at practices, games, community events, and program activities.

* Assist in producing content that highlights student-athletes, coaches, alumni, and program culture.

* Edit content for social media, website, email, and promotional use.

* Identify creative storytelling opportunities throughout the season and offseason.

Engagement

* Monitor social media trends and recommend new content ideas.

* Assist with fan engagement initiatives and interactive content.

* Help strengthen the program's digital community through consistent and engaging storytelling.

* Work closely with communications, marketing, recruiting, creative services, and external relations staff.

* Support digital campaigns tied to ticket sales, special events, fundraising initiatives, and community engagement efforts.

* Assist with other content and creative projects as assigned.
